14. Chassis intrusion connector (4-1 pin CHASSIS)
This lead is for a chassis designed with intrusion detection feature.
This requires an external detection mechanism such as a chassis
intrusion sensor or microswitch. When you remove any chassis
component, the sensor triggers and sends a high-level signal to this
lead to record a chassis intrusion event.
By default, the pins labeled "Chassis Signal" and "Ground" are shorted
with a jumper cap. To use the chassis intrusion detection feature,
remove the jumper cap from the pins.

15. System panel connector (20-pin PANEL)
This connector accommodates several system front panel functions.

The System Panel connector is color-coded for easy and foolproof
connection. Take note of the specific connector colors as described.
